•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:ゲームでのポート開放のメリット?)

ゲームでのポート開放のメリット

このQ&Aのポイント
  • ゲームでのポート開放のメリットとは?
  • マンション回線でのポート開放の影響は?
  • ゲームプレイにおけるポート開放のメリットとは?

質問者が選んだベストアンサー

  • ベストアンサー
  • neko-ten
  • ベストアンサー率55% (1287/2335)
回答No.4

よくある間違いですが・・・ ポート解放 → 対象の通信ポートが閉じられているので開ける作業 たとえば、HTTPアクセス(一般的なWebアクセス)には80番ポートを使います。 もし、このポートが閉じてしまっているとそもそも通信ができません。 80番ポートが閉じている場合、HTTPアクセスできませんのでサイト自体が全く見れなくなります。 それに対してよく誤用されるのは、一般的にポートフォワーディングって呼ばれます。 対象のポートを使ってインバウンドアクセスが行われた場合に、LAN内部の特定ノードにパケットを送る仕組み。 (一応、ポート変換の機能もあります。NAPTの一機能) これはポートがあいてることは前提ですが、それだけだとインバウンドで入ってきたパケットはどこに送ればいいのかわかりません。 そのため、「~~番ポートで送られてきたインバウンド通信パケットは、ノードAに送る」って設定が必要なのです。 (HTTPアクセスを行った場合のレスポンスのような場合は、ヘッダにどこに送るべきか記載されているので不必要) 上記二つは全く別物ですが、よく混同されています。 ポート解放とポート転送っていうべきなんですが・・・。 ゲームにしろ、それ以外の通信にしろ、いわゆるサーバクライアント方式(MMOとか)であれば通信ポートを開ける作業だけでよいです。 ポートフォワーディングの設定は要りません。 もしインバウンドサーバ機能を使いたいのであれば、特別ルーティング設定をしない限りポートフォワーディングを行う必要があります。 >「回線が悪い」という人間に対し、「ポート開放ぐらいしろ」という >会話のやり取りを聞き、回線環境が良くなるのかな?と思い、 >質問させていただきました。 ポートフォワーディングではなくポート解放のことであれば、クライアントによりますがあるっちゃーあります。 対象ポートが閉じられている場合、クライアントによっては代替ポートを使って通信します。 その場合、サーバ側で送信ポート変えたりしないといけないので回線状況が悪く感じることはあるかもしれません。 ・・・Skypeとかそうなんですが、ゲームでそういったことをしてるかどうかは一般的に公開あまりしないですね。 ただ、こういった事情以外で回線効率が上がることなどは原則ありません。 てか、原則#1さんのとおりにポート閉じてたら通信できませんし。 >実際は、ゲームの側の設定でポート変更した結果 >ホストとして部屋の設定は出来、ポート開放とはなんだったんだろう? >といった疑問だけが残った訳です。 設定でポート変えた→あいてないポートからあいてるポートに変えた ってことですよね。 出口のカギ開けられないので、他の出口から出たよ!ってかんじです。 もし他の出口にも鍵掛かってて出れなければ通信できなかった・・・ってなります。 ご質問者様の場合は、自宅にグローバルIP割り振られてるんじゃないかね。 それであれば一般的に管理者さん側にポート解放とかそういったものの依頼は要りません。 自宅ルーティング設定を変えることで解決します。 ルータ使ってなければ何も設定要らない。PCのファイアウォールの設定くらい。 依頼が必要なのは共用NAT使ってる人とかですが、この場合はどういうルーティングしてるかで変わりますしね・・・。

acecaffe58
質問者

お礼

参考にさせていただきます。 ありがとうございました。

その他の回答 (3)

noname#242220
noname#242220
回答No.3

この場合の『ポート解放』はPCのファイアーウォールの事を指して居ると考えます。 ですから一般に呼ぶ『ポート解放』とは異なります。 PCは標準で普段使用しない通信ポートは閉じられています。 オンラインゲームの場合は普段閉じているポートを使用する訳で此れが使えないとデータのやり取りが出来ない。 >反応や判定が正確で速い、重い部屋でも快適にできる・・ と言う事は有りません却って設定に失敗すると自分のHDが『丸見え』に成りかねません。

acecaffe58
質問者

お礼

参考にさせていただきます。 ありがとうございました。

  • rasuka555
  • ベストアンサー率49% (175/352)
回答No.2

補足などを読みました。 ポート開放はホストになるときにのみ必要なことです。 通常のままだとこちらから情報を出して、こちらの情報を受け取るだけなのでポート開放は不要ですが、 ホストの場合、「外のパソコンからの情報を受け入れる」ことが必要になるので、 「ルータに特定のポート番号で、(特定のソフトを使用して)アクセスしてきたら、特定の機器へデータを送ります」という設定が必要になるのです。 これがポート開放なわけです。 よってポート開放で処理が高速化するということはありえません。

参考URL:
http://www.akakagemaru.info/port/faq-openport.html
acecaffe58
質問者

お礼

参考にさせていただきます。 ありがとうございました。

  • neko_mama
  • ベストアンサー率39% (979/2462)
回答No.1

ポートが開いてなければ通信が出来ません 遅い早いじゃなく 繋がらないのです

acecaffe58
質問者

お礼

回答ありがとうございます。 そうですね。 ちょっと質問が悪かったと思います。 補足しておきます!

acecaffe58
質問者

補足

質問に至った経緯ですが、 普通にオンラインゲームは出来ます。 ホストとして部屋を立てられなかった事があり、 その対策としてポートの開放を勧められました。 実際は、ゲームの側の設定でポート変更した結果 ホストとして部屋の設定は出来、 ポート開放とはなんだったんだろう? といった疑問だけが残った訳です。 また、オンラインゲーム内で、 「回線が悪い」という人間に対し、「ポート開放ぐらいしろ」という 会話のやり取りを聞き、回線環境が良くなるのかな?と思い、 質問させていただきました。

関連するQ&A

専門家に質問してみよう